This evening around 5:45pm at the Chehalis Wildlife area (Schouweiler Rd. wetland) just outside of Elma, there were approximately 4 American Bitterns singing in different parts of the wetland. There were many swallows flying around too. I was able to ID quite a few Tree Swallows with a few Violet-green Swallows mixed in. The Osprey pair was on the nest snag as well.
